Mesothelioma Compensation For Victims and Their Families

When diagnosed with mesothelioma the patients and their family members experience many losses. Compensation can help to offset the losses, providing families with peace of mind.

Top mesothelioma lawyers have access data about asbestos companies and can examine your work history to determine if you were exposed to asbestos. Most mesothelioma cases are settled before trial.

Veterans Affairs Benefits

Veterans suffering from mesothelioma and other asbestos-related illnesses may be eligible for a number of veterans benefits. VA disability compensation pensions, health care, and disability compensation are among the benefits available to veterans. A mesothelioma lawyer can assist the veteran, or their family, make a claim for the benefits they deserve.

To qualify for veterans benefits The first step is to make a claim for mesothelioma with the VA. In order to do so veterans must meet basic eligibility requirements. This includes a mesothelioma diagnosis medical records, evidence of military service.

Mesothelioma, an asbestos-related disease is caused by asbestos fibers are inhaled. The fibers get stuck in the linings of the lungs and abdomen. The asbestos can cause irritation to the lining and causes it to change, leading to cancer.

The VA offers access to some of America's top mesothelioma experts. They provide a variety of treatment options like radiotherapy and chemotherapy. These treatments can increase the life span of a patient and also reduce symptoms.

The VA will typically cover travel expenses of mesothelioma sufferers to see these specialists. A mesothelioma specialist can provide veterans with advice on how to manage their symptoms. They can also connect patients with other veterans who have experienced the same type asbestos exposure.

A mesothelioma specialist can identify mesothelioma attorneys on the basis of an examination of the body as well as a review of the patient's medical records and blood tests to determine the tumor's markers. A biopsy can be used to confirm the diagnosis.

A veteran's asbestos exposure must have occurred at least 50% when they were on active duty to be qualified for VA benefits. This percentage is referred to as their "service-connection." Neither age nor income level affects a veteran's ability to qualify for VA benefits, but a mesothelioma lawyer will assist the vet in determining the most suitable benefits available.

Veterans who are diagnosed with mesothelioma or other asbestos-related illnesses, can receive monthly disability payments from the VA. This benefit can assist a mesothelioma patient and their family members in addressing the costs of living. These benefits could include a stipend, or home loan assistance, as well as funeral costs.

Trust Funds

When asbestos-related illnesses are diagnosed, families often face substantial financial burdens. Compensation from a mesothelioma lawsuit, trust fund or VA benefits can help pay for medical expenses and provide support. A mesothelioma lawyer can help determine what type of compensation is best for a client's unique situation.

Asbestos settlements and trial verdicts can take an extended time to reach. Due to this some asbestos victims might choose to file a claim with an asbestos trust fund for faster payout. Trust funds contain billions of dollars of dollars set aside to pay asbestos victims. The law requires asbestos-related companies that are liable to set up trust funds and ensure they have enough cash to pay for future claims.

To be eligible for a payout from the mesothelioma foundation the victims must submit extensive documentation about their asbestos exposure. This includes medical records, work histories, military service records as well as a list of the asbestos-related companies that a victim was exposed to. An experienced mesothelioma attorney can assist victims with gathering the necessary documents and evidence required to make an effective trust fund claim.

Mesothelioma lawyers can also determine whether a patient's condition is a prerequisite for an expedited review. The mesothelioma claim will be evaluated ahead of other asbestos trust fund cases, and they will be paid earlier. This schedule is based on the number of trust fund claims have been filed and the payout percentages have been adjusted.

While asbestos bankruptcy trusts provide more rapid compensation than lawsuits but they do not compensate victims for all of their expenses. Asbestos lawyers can file a mesothelioma litigation lawsuit on behalf of their clients and they can also assist veterans in obtaining VA benefits.

It can be difficult to obtain compensation for mesothelioma but it's worth it when you require assistance in settling medical bills and living costs. Financial compensation can ease the stress of mesothelioma treatment as well as can provide a source of income for family members. It can even enable people to take part in clinical trials and other experimental mesothelioma treatments, which can prolong their lives and enhance their quality of life.

Settlements

Anyone diagnosed with mesothelioma is likely to suffer financial and personal losses. Settlements can help offset these costs and provide closure. A top mesothelioma lawyer will examine all legal options available for compensation for their client. This includes asbestos trusts as well as wrongful death suits, among other types claims.

Lawyers who specialize in mesothelioma can use the client's family and work history to identify asbestos-related companies that could be responsible for their exposure. If the defendant is operating and has a lawsuit in place, it can be filed to collect compensation. A mesothelioma litigation case can be settled outside of court or argued to the verdict of a trial. Whatever the case, the top mesothelioma lawyers will ensure the highest payout.

If the parties in mesothelioma cases do not wish to settle the case out of court, they will be able to go to trial. Trials can take a long time and require expert testimony as well as depositions. The jury will decide whether the asbestos-containing products of the company caused asbestos exposure, and also how much compensation to award the plaintiff.

Mesothelioma patients and their families can receive compensation through veteran benefits as well as private health insurance, long-term disability insurance, Medicare and Medicaid. These benefits may cover a portion or all the cost of treatment, assist in paying living expenses and help with home care if necessary. A skilled mesothelioma attorney can explain the types of benefits available to each individual client and how they might be eligible for specific benefits.

If a patient dies from mesothelioma, their family or estate may start a wrongful-death lawsuit to claim compensation from the asbestos companies responsible for their exposure. This type of lawsuit is similar to a personal injury suit but with a higher amount of compensation awarded.

The majority of mesothelioma cases are identified and treated before the expiration of the statute of limitation. If the patient has passed away, their family members can turn their asbestos lawsuit into a wrongful death lawsuit with the assistance of an experienced mesothelioma attorney. This could save costs for legal and time when compared to filing a new wrongful death lawsuit. A mesothelioma lawyer will be able to determine the likelihood of a conversion.

Trial Verdicts

The best way to receive compensation for asbestos companies is to file a mesothelioma lawsuit. These companies have exposed millions of people to asbestos over the course of time and they should be held accountable for their negligence. Compensation can help victims to pay for treatment, help their families and give them an understanding of justice for their losses.

Settlements and verdicts in mesothelioma cases differ greatly based on the particular circumstances of each case. In general, mesothelioma claims settlements range from $1 million to $1.4million. The time required for a victim to receive mesothelioma compensation also varies. The most efficient method to speed up a claim is to work with a seasoned mesothelioma legal, similar website, firm.

Unlike most personal injury lawsuits, mesothelioma lawsuits typically settle out of court rather than going to trial. The plaintiffs and their lawyers still need to create and file an extensive legal claim. A mesothelioma lawyer can help you to build an argument that will win you the justice you deserve.

In the event that a mesothelioma lawsuit does go to trial, a jury will determine how much a plaintiff should be awarded for their losses. Plaintiffs may be awarded damages for medical costs, lost income, pain, suffering funeral expenses, and other losses, based on the evidence presented. Mesothelioma verdicts can be overturned or reduced after trial, that's why it's important to choose an attorney who is knowledgeable about how to handle these kinds of cases and has experience handling appeals if needed.

When the asbestos industry was inundated with mesothelioma-related lawsuits, a number of firms filed for bankruptcy and established trust funds to compensate victims. You may be able to receive compensation from these trust funds in addition the damages you receive through a lawsuit, depending on the laws of your state. A mesothelioma lawyer can help you determine if you are eligible to receive trust funds and how to apply.

Wrongful death lawsuits are brought by the loved ones of a survivor or the estate of the deceased individual. They seek to recover compensation for economic and noneconomic damages from asbestos-related companies that caused the death of the individual.
